The 2014 RoboCop features a significant visual upgrade. The suit undergoes a transformation from the classic silver aesthetic to a tactical, "stealth" black design. The action sequences are fluid and high-octane, utilizing modern CGI to show RoboCop’s tactical scanning and rapid-fire capabilities. While the 1987 film focused on the privatization of the police force, the 2014 reboot focuses on the automation of violence. It asks a chilling question: If a robot pulls the trigger, who is responsible? By keeping Murphy’s emotions intact—and then suppressed via software—the film explores how technology can be used to override human empathy for the sake of efficiency and profit.
